- 博客(4)
- 收藏
- 关注
转载 二进制状态枚举
定义 先给出子集的定义:子集是一个数学概念:如果集合A的任意一个元素都是集合B的元素,那么集合A称为集合B的子集。 用途 在写程序的时候,有时候我们可能需要暴力枚举出所有的情况,这时可以考虑通过二进制来枚举子集来尝试解决问题。 解释 假设我们现在有5个小球,上面分别标号了0,1,2,3,4代表这些小球的权值,现在要像你求出这些小球的权值可以组成的所有情况。 我们用二进制的思维来考虑这个...
2018-07-26 15:53:04 782
转载 hdu 1796【容斥】
让你找 1 ~ (n - 1)内,能够被 一个数组m中 任意的数 整除的数有多少 #include <iostream> #include <algorithm> #include <cmath> #include <cstring> #include <cstdio> using namespace std; typedef...
2018-07-26 11:48:40 189
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人